The Nigeria FMCG Games 2016 is gradually progressing.

The football event, which kicked-off on Saturday, 28th May 2016, has  been exciting and fun-filled, with amazing football skills and intense competition.

Match Day 2 came with a lot of goals and surprises from competing teams.

The first match had Nestle and Dufil Prima battle for supremacy in a thrilling football game. The first 10mins of the match saw the Remita champions with 3 goals, and by the end of first half they were dominating with 5goals to nil.

With 5 goals in first half, the 2nd half was not a very palatable experience for Dufil Prima, as tension had built up, giving Nestle ample opportunity to score three more goals, and ending the match with 8 goals to nil.

MVP of the match was Nestle’s Iche Promise.

The second match of the day was between Unilever and Friesland Campina. The match began with Unilever dominating with 2goals, but a late penalty in favour of Friesland ended the first half with 2-1.

The second half of the match was highly competitive, with Friesland coming back better and equalising. But the FMCG Games defending champions refused to back down, ending the match with a 3-2 against Friesland.

MVP of the match was Timothy James of Unilever.
